THE MIGHTY I AM
The religious movement know as “The Mighty I am” was started by Guy Ballard or better know by his pen name, Godfre Ray King. This movement is like so many of the smaller cult movements in that they by definition deny the deity of Christ teaching that Jesus was an ascended master not the Son of God. They deny other Christian doctrines like teaching that the Trinity is a Christian myth and that the Holy Spirit is your I am presence. They out right reject Christianity and the belief that Jesus Christ is not Lord and Savior. “The Christ [not Jesus] is in reality the MASTER WITHIN!” (The voice of the I AM, December, 1936 p.37) They also teach that salvation is gained by a lifetime of good works and occult practices and that heaven and hell are states of consciousness.
This is an New Age cult that has described its purpose as to bring “ ascended I AM power” to America. That America may fulfill her cosmic destiny as the world’s repository of “Light.” As you can see by the stated purpose this cult mixes New Age with humanistic and narcissistic teachings that “you” have to the “power” that “you” are able to control the out come of all that happens. They believe that man is inwardly divine. In many ways this movement compares to is the Emergent Church movement and where their teaching are headed with poor eisegesis of scripture and reading themselves into biblical teachings instead of Christ. “[Jesus States:] try to always to remember that you are human beings so-called, but you are gods and goddesses in embryo.” (Godfre Ray King, The “I AM” Discourses, p.273-274)
This movement as most cult groups claim to hold the only truth and this is by revealed teachings. They claim to be among the vanguard of movements bring light and truth to the world; to be the only way to attaining the “Ascension” or spiritual resurrection. It is taught within this group that the Second Coming happened when Jesus appeared to the Ballards as an ascended master. This movement is heavily into occult practices. They believe in Spiritism, voluntary possessions, magic, and retributive magic.
